When a customer has purchased recurring membership payment (until cancelled) is there a way to set up an unsubscribe link somewhere on a website so it can allow a them to unsubscribe from the recurring payments and the membership.
In other words is there user friendly way we can provide a member a link so they can stop recurring payment without them having to go into PayPal and navigate their way round to stop the billing cycle and cancel membership access in the process.
If not is there an alternative way (merchant account or whatever) that could solve this?
…is there user friendly way we can provide a member a link so they can stop recurring payment without them having to go into PayPal…
The user must cancel the subscription, from within their PayPal account. That’s PayPal’s rule for standard PayPal subscription payment:
Thank you for your reply. As member would have been a valued customer, is there a way to trigger an email to thank the customer for their business as they unsubscribe from the membership?
No email, but how about this instead? Link to a “Cancel Subscription page,” on your site, that contains the [wp_eMember_cancel_subscription_link] shortcode. Right before the shortcode, you can place a lengthy and perhaps tearful video; begging them not to go, but that you value their patronage with heartfelt thanks, should they proceed to click the link created by the [wp_eMember_cancel_subscription_link] shortcode.
